Wearable Tech: A Palette for the Future

Imagine a world where your heartbeat translates into a vibrant symphony, or your movements sculpt 3D landscapes in real-time. This is the potential of wearable tech, offering a dynamic canvas that responds to human emotions, actions, and intentions.

  • Interactive Art Installations: Wearables can transform static art pieces into immersive experiences. Imagine walking through an installation where your body movements trigger light displays, sound effects, or even changes in the surrounding environment.
  • Gesture-Based Design: Artists can now utilize wearable sensors to translate their gestures and movements into digital creations. This opens up a realm of possibilities for sculpting, painting, and composing music using intuitive physical interaction.
  • Personalized Digital Fashion: Wearables are blurring the lines between clothing and technology, allowing designers to create garments that react to light, sound, or even the wearers mood. Imagine a dress that shifts colors with your heartbeat or a jacket that displays interactive patterns based on your surroundings.

Ethical Considerations in the Wearable Creative Revolution

As with any powerful technology, wearable tech for creative expression raises important ethical considerations:

  • Data Privacy: Wearables collect vast amounts of personal data. It is crucial to ensure that this data is handled responsibly and ethically, with transparent consent and robust security measures in place.
  • Accessibility and Inclusivity: Wearable technology should be accessible to all, regardless of their physical abilities or socioeconomic status. Designers must consider the needs of diverse users and strive for inclusivity in the development and deployment of wearable creative tools.
  • Authenticity and Ownership: The lines between human creativity and AI-assisted creation are becoming increasingly blurred. It is important to have clear guidelines and ethical frameworks that address issues of authorship, originality, and the value of human artistic expression in an age of technological augmentation.
